I really enjoyed this book for multiple reasons. One of the best qualities of this book, in particular, is that it is interactive. You are able to open, spin, and pull different parts of the book to make Pepper (the dog) run, turn, and reappear. For example, there is a barn and in order to see what happened to Pepper, you have to open the barn doors and then you will see him running with the pigs. This book also did a really good job of showing movement within the illustrations. You can tell that the little girl is running after her puppy because of the leaves that are flying up behind her. Going more along with the illustrations, I also liked how vibrant and colorful this book is, You can not help but feel happy and excited to look at the next page because of it. I think the big idea of this book is that finding the perfect pumpkin may not always be the easiest task, but with the right helper, you can find the perfect pumpkin.… (mais)
